Call Forwarding

Description
Call Forwarding allows you to send your calls to another extension, to an outside line, or to voice
mail. Call Forwarding can be set or canceled under the following conditions from either your own
extension or from an alternate extension:
Call Forwarding - All Calls
Call Forwarding - Busy
Call Forwarding - No Answer

Call Forwarding-All Calls

When Call Forwarding - All Calls is set, all incoming calls to an extension are immediately
forwarded.
